What is an Import Vehicle?

An import vehicle is any vehicle that is brought into a country from another country. Imports tend to be spoken of interchangeably with foreign cars, but that's not always correct. While import vehicles are foreign, not all foreign vehicles are imports. This is because import status is typically determined by the country in which the vehicle's manufacturing was completed. Many Asian and European car companies have manufacturing plants in countries across the world to serve a larger audience (and for that matter, American companies do, too), so if the vehicle's country of assembly is non-US and it is in the United States, it is an import.

On the other hand, a foreign car refers to any vehicle that originates from an automaker based outside of the country, regardless of how it arrived. For example, the Japanese brand Honda has a manufacturing plant in Alabama. If your purchase a Honda that was manufactured in the United States, you have a foreign car (because Honda is a Japanese brand) but not an import (because the vehicle was manufactured here).

In contrast, if you purchase a Honda that was manufactured in Mexico but sold by a US dealer, the car is both foreign and an import.

Many motorists don't think about checking their vehicle's country of assembly. You may be surprised to learn that some well-known domestic brands will import cars made at manufacturing plants in other countries. In other words, you might not realize you are driving an import when you purchase from a domestic brand.

Import Car Repair Shops

Import car repair is simply the maintenance and repair of import cars. Mechanics offering import car services need to have special knowledge, parts, and tools to provide the best service.
